Transaction 83ceb5564fe0d90a5f64a55d47e56af65622059e45e3a5e1a625e109e44e5701
1 Input
2 Outputs
- 83ceb5564fe0d90a5f64a55d47e56af65622059e45e3a5e1a625e109e44e5701:0
- 83ceb5564fe0d90a5f64a55d47e56af65622059e45e3a5e1a625e109e44e5701:1
value 1500000
address 14Mch1ZEFC9Jv8PgW8KRyzUx2ohgpaJQ9y
value 21700554
address 1B9SnRbG8CRN24YUReByxP2ukt5EGZDRNi